Knowledge of your GDPR compliance is essential to your organizations ability to succeed with its compliance work. The purpose of this Assessment  is to detect any gaps in the level of knowledge – overall and in relevant groups in your organization. It takes 15-30 min to complete this Assessment.. The Assessment are structured in such a way that you will be to identify the extent of any gaps and the precise nature of the gaps.
